neishheeł -- to dream, have a dream
ntséskees-- to think.
ntsísékééz ---I am thinking.
Conjugating Navajo verbs is very hard, there are modes, aspects and tenses and things like 1st, 2nd and 3rd person become part of the verb too.

In Navajo the word for belt is sis. A traditional Navajo belt of leather with silver conchos sewn on it is called sisŁigai.
The Navajo word, "Bilaganaana" means White Man of White person.

The Navajo word for sky is yá. Or yádiłhił or yá'ąąsh.
